How much do gravestone cleaners get paid?

Gravestone cleaners typically earn between $10 and $20 per hour, depending on experience, location, and the complexity of the work. Some may charge a flat fee per headstone or work as independent contractors, which can affect overall earnings.

Can you make a living cleaning headstones?

A grave cleaner or headstone cleaner can make a living by providing specialized cleaning and restoration services for cemeteries and families. Income depends on factors such as experience, reputation, and the number of clients, with some professionals working full-time and earning a steady income. Certification in conservation techniques and proper use of cleaning tools can improve job prospects and earnings.

What are grave cleaners?

Grave cleaners are professionals who maintain and clean gravesites, headstones, and surrounding areas in cemeteries. Their work typically includes removing debris, washing and gently scrubbing headstones, trimming grass, and sometimes restoring inscriptions or repairing minor damage. Grave cleaners help preserve the dignity and appearance of gravesites, ensuring they remain respectful and well-kept for visitors. This service is often sought by families who are unable to regularly maintain loved ones' graves due to distance or other limitations.

What is the difference between Grave Cleaner vs Cemetery Groundskeeper?

AspectGrave CleanerCemetery Groundskeeper
CertificationsNone required, but safety training preferredOften requires groundskeeping or horticulture certifications
Work EnvironmentPrimarily at gravesites, focusing on cleaning and maintenanceBroader outdoor cemetery areas, including landscaping and general upkeep
Job DutiesCleaning gravestones, removing debris, maintaining grave sitesLawn care, planting, maintaining pathways, and overall cemetery appearance

While both roles involve outdoor cemetery work, Grave Cleaners focus on cleaning and maintaining individual graves, whereas Cemetery Groundskeepers handle broader landscaping and grounds maintenance. Understanding these differences helps in choosing the right career path or job search focus within cemetery services.

What are the typical challenges faced by a Grave Cleaner, and how can they be managed effectively?

Grave Cleaners often work outdoors in varying weather conditions, which can make the job physically demanding. Managing respect for the site and interacting with visitors or grieving families requires sensitivity and professionalism. Additionally, tasks may involve handling delicate headstones and working with cleaning agents, so attention to detail and following safety protocols are essential. Building a reliable routine and maintaining clear communication with cemetery management can help address these challenges and ensure respectful, high-quality service.

How do you become a gravekeeper?

To become a gravekeeper, you typically need a high school diploma or equivalent and may require training in cemetery maintenance, safety procedures, and equipment use. Some positions prefer experience in groundskeeping or related fields, and certifications in safety or horticulture can be beneficial.
